Improved Actions using The Renormalization Group

Abstract

We introduce a numerical method to study critical properties near classical and quantum phase transitions. Our method applies ideas of the Tensor Renormalization Group to obtain an improved action which is used to extract critical properties by performing Monte Carlo simulations on relatively small system sizes. We demonstrate this method on the XY model in three dimensions. Our method may provide a framework with which to efficiently study universal properties in a large class of phase transitions.
